Sightseeing and checked baggage issues on a DCA to IAD connection

I am considering an award routing on United to ROM (ORD-DCA, IAD-ROM) with various 3 to 6 hour layover options. My thought was that this might offer the opportunity to do some taxicab-type sightseeing in DC since we've never been there.

We will have large checked suitcases that I was asssuming would be checked for free at ORD since we have a transcontinental flight. Can anyone explain if indeed our luggage would be free of charge on an itinerary such as this, and if sightseeing within such timeframes is realistic?
